Not trying to be sneaky or anything, but the destination is Indian Lake, MI.  From Cincinnati, OH  It's not Appleseed related.  I asked this here because this is the only forum of national people who are friendly enough to answer that I am a member of.
Title: Re: Traveling routes in Indiana
Post by: Bill 3 on May 31, 2010, 11:27:56 PM
Use 31.  You will have to put up with 465 when circling Indy.  Also make sure you don't end up on business 31 through South Bend.  Stick to the bypass.  31 through most of northern Indiana is almost as good as a freeway.  Another thing to note.  There is construction on 65 as you approach where I am at in NW Indiana if you choose that route.  It varies from minor delay to take a nap depending on what they are doing and the time of day.
